Problems solved by technology

[0004] The quantitative index in the current quality standard is paeoniflorin in Radix Paeoniae Rubra, and Chishan Powder is identified by TLC. No qualitative or quantitative detection is carried out for Epimedium, nor is menthol and Chishan Powder identified. Quantitative detection, so the standard is relatively simple and cannot effectively detect product quality
[0005] The company has done a lot of research on the detection method of Jingushang Spray, such as: developed a method for the simultaneous determination of paeoniflorin, icariin, ellagic acid, epimedin A, The content determination method of Huodin B, Epimedin C and Baohuoside I, the method is convenient to operate, strong in specificity, good in separation, high in stability, high in efficiency and can simultaneously treat seven active ingredients in the muscle and bone injury spray The advantages of content determination, but this technology has the following problems: ① The epimedium in the product has not been qualitatively identified and menthol has not been quantitatively detected, so the quality of epimedium and menthol in the product cannot be fully controlled. ②The main component of Epimedium in the product is icariin, and the main component of Chishan Powder is ellagic acid. The existing detection method is to simultaneously measure 7 components in the product. There is no targeted detection method for ellagic acid in icariin and Chishan powder, and the detection time is longer, and the separation and stability need to be further improved
[0006] Therefore, in order to solve the problem of not being able to fully control the quality of epimedium and the content of menthol in the product in the prior art, further improve the separation and stability of the content detection method, shorten the detection time, save detection costs, and thus comprehensively and effectively detect Product quality situation and control of product quality

Abstract

The invention relates to a detection method for a spray for tendon and bone injury, which is used for qualitative identification of icariin in the product, content determination of the icariin in the product by high performance liquid chromatography, and determination by gas chromatography. The content of menthol in the product is determined by high performance liquid chromatography; the method for qualitative and quantitative detection of Epimedium and the quantitative detection of menthol and Chishan powder are added in the present invention relative to the existing standard, and further The quality of the product is effectively controlled; the method of the present invention shows that the instrument precision and linear relationship are good, the specificity is strong, and the stability and repeatability are good.

Description

technical field [0001] The invention relates to the field of medical inventions, in particular to a detection method of a spray for musculoskeletal injuries. Background technique [0002] Soft tissue injury refers to the human skin, subcutaneous superficial and deep fascia, muscle, tendon, tendon sheath, ligament, joint capsule, synovial sac, intervertebral disc, peripheral nerve blood vessels and other tissues caused by various acute trauma or chronic strain, as well as their own disease and pathology. The pathological damage, called soft tissue injury, clinical manifestations: pain, swelling, deformity, dysfunction. [0003] Muscle and bone injury spray is developed and produced by Guizhou Yuanyuan Pharmaceutical Co., Ltd. It has the functions of promoting blood circulation and removing blood stasis, reducing swelling and relieving pain, and is mainly used for soft tissue injury.
